Secure Democracy Foundation

The Secure Democracy Foundation is an advocacy group whose tax filings claim to be “nonpartisan organization providing expert analysis and research on election-related law.” 1

    Background

    The Secure Democracy Foundation was founded in 2022 by Voting Rights Lab co-founder Megan Lewis. According to IRS tax exemption forms, the Foundation was started through a $4.8 million donation from the New Venture Fund in 2022. As of 2023, the Foundation is the parent organization of Voting Rights Lab. 3

    The Foundation is the sister 501(c)(3) sister organization to Secure Democracy USA, a 501(c)(4) nonprofit that was reformed from election advocacy group Secure Democracy following the latter’s dissolving as a legal entity in November 2021. 2 3 4

    Financials

    According to its 2024 tax filings, the Secure Democracy Foundation reported a revenue of $11,111,406, expenses of $9,026,038, and net assets of $3,724,595. 5

    According to its 2023 tax filings, the Foundation reported a revenue of $7,441,411, expenses of $7,371,161, and net assets of $1,639,227. 6

    Funding

    According to its tax filings, between 2022 and 2024 the Secure Democracy Foundation donated grants to several organizations including Secure Democracy USA, Civil Survivor Project, Unite Oregon, and Free and Fair Elections USA. 7 8 9

    Leadership

    Megan Lewis is listed as the executive director for the Secure Democracy Foundation, according to its 2024 tax filings. 10 Lewis is also a co-founder and executive director of the Voting Rights Lab and was previously the executive vice president of Everytown for Gun Safety. 11
